Sunday, January 22 • 4:00pm - 5:30pm
Hey Riddle Riddle (SOLD OUT)

Sign up or log in to save this to your schedule, view media, leave feedback and see who's attending!

This show is sold out. Tickets may be available at the door on the day of the show.

Riddles! Puzzles! WhoDunnits! Adal Rifai, Erin Keif and JPC try and solve a few of these every episode while discussing and dissecting along the way. You can play along while listening but can you solve the questions before we do?? (You absolutely will.) ($35 Front/Center, $28 Rear/Sides, All Ages)

Adal Rifai

Adal Rifai is an improviser, podcaster, producer and writer in Chicago. Adal performs at iO Theater with weekly show "Whirled News Tonight" and teaches improv at University of Illinois at Chicago. He co-hosts the podcast "Hello From the Magic Tavern" as Chunt the shapeshifter and... Read More →
